1. Using Samsung’s Find My Mobile

Samsung’s Find My Mobile feature allows you to remotely unlock your device, provided you set it up in advance. If you’ve registered your phone with a Samsung account, follow these steps:

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Access a web browser on your computer or another device and navigate to the Find My Mobile website.
  2. Log in using your Samsung account credentials.
  3. Select your Samsung Galaxy S9 Plus from the list of registered devices.
  4. Click on the Unlock option.
  5. Follow the on-screen prompts to complete the process.

The beauty of this method is that it preserves your data, making it the preferred choice for most users.

2. Factory Reset the Device

If the first method is not an option—for example, if you haven’t registered with Samsung—performing a factory reset is your next solution. Keep in mind that this method will erase all data from your device, so it should be your last resort.

Performing a Factory Reset

To factory reset your Samsung Galaxy S9 Plus:

Accessing Recovery Mode
  1. Turn off your Samsung Galaxy S9 Plus completely.
  2. Press and hold the Volume Up, Bixby, and Power buttons simultaneously until the Samsung logo appears.
  3. Release the buttons once you see the Android Recovery menu.
Resetting the Device
  1. Use the Volume buttons to navigate to the option labeled Wipe data/factory reset.
  2. Press the Power button to select it.
  3. Navigate to Yes and confirm the selection.
  4. Once the reset is complete, choose Reboot system now.

After the device has rebooted, it will be restored to its factory settings, allowing you to set it up as new.

3. Using Android Device Manager

If your Samsung Galaxy S9 Plus is linked to a Google account, you can use the Android Device Manager to unlock your device.

Steps to Unlock via Android Device Manager

  • Open a web browser and navigate to the Android Device Manager (now Google Find My Device).
  • Log in with the Google account linked to your device.
  • Select your Samsung Galaxy S9 Plus from the list of devices.
  • Choose the option Erase Device to remove the screen lock.

As with the factory reset, this option will result in the loss of your data, so use it judiciously.

Preventative Measures to Avoid Future Lockouts

Once you regain access to your device, consider implementing these preventative measures to avoid similar issues in the future:

1. Keep a Backup of Your Data

Ensure that your data is consistently backed up. You can do this through Samsung Cloud or Google Drive. Regular backups can help you restore important information if you need to factory reset your device in the future.

2. Use Biometric Access

Taking advantage of biometric features such as fingerprint or facial recognition can save you from needing to use a pattern or PIN lock. This allows for easier access while still maintaining security.

3. Note Your Unlock Pattern

If you prefer the pattern lock, consider sketching it discreetly or storing it in a secure app designed for password management.

Is there any way to unlock the Samsung S9 Plus using Samsung’s Find My Mobile?

Yes, you can use Samsung’s Find My Mobile service to unlock your Samsung S9 Plus, provided you had set it up prior to forgetting your pattern. To utilize this feature, simply go to the Find My Mobile website and log in with your Samsung account credentials. Once logged in, you should see an option to unlock your device remotely.

After selecting the unlock option, follow the on-screen instructions to complete the process. This method allows you to unlock the device without taking any data loss into account. Therefore, it’s a highly recommended option if you have access to your Samsung account and if the service was activated on your phone beforehand.

What if I don’t remember my Google or Samsung account information?

If you cannot remember your Google or Samsung account credentials, it can make unlocking your Samsung S9 Plus more complex. In this scenario, you may need to attempt a recovery process for both accounts. This typically involves accessing the respective website for Google or Samsung and following their recovery instructions. Usually, you can retrieve your account details by answering security questions or receiving verification codes via email or SMS.

If recovering your accounts is unsuccessful, your best option is to perform a factory reset. As mentioned earlier, this process will delete all data on the device. It’s crucial to weigh the loss of data against the need to regain access to your phone. In some instances, you may also consider reaching out to Samsung customer support for additional assistance.
